Earnings Call Q3 2024

October 24, 2024 - AI Summary

**Strong Sales Growth**: Danone reported a like-for-like sales increase of 4.2% for Q3 2024, continuing its trend of broad-based growth across all geographies. Notably, the China, North Asia, and Oceania region saw impressive growth of 8%, driven by robust volume mix contributions from Specialized Nutrition and EDP categories.
**Volume Mix Improvement**: The company achieved a record volume mix contribution of 3.6%, indicating a shift towards higher-value products and effective execution of their premiumization strategy. This is expected to remain a focus as Danone aims to differentiate its portfolio and improve margins.
**Challenges in Pricing**: European pricing was negative for the quarter at -2.4%, attributed to competitive pressures and selective pricing investments. With inflation in input costs expected to continue, there is uncertainty around future pricing power, particularly in Europe, where consumer dynamics are more challenging.
